Q. Explain about Vertical Vessels?
Vertical vessels shall normally be designed as self-supporting units, and shall resist overturn based upon wind or earthquake considerations.
1). Skirts or lugs shall be used to support tower or large vertical vessels, and are preferred for vessels having top-entering agitators. 2). Leg supports shall be limited to spherical and cylindrical vessels that meet the following requirements:
• Design temperature does not exceed 450oF (232oC).
• Service is noncyclic and nonpulsating.
• Vessel height-to-diameter ratio does not exceed 5. (Height is defined as the distance from base of support to the top tangent line of the vessel.
